**Mgmt Meeting Minutes — Retiring the Brightline Range**

Quick recap for sales leads at Fenholt Supplies: we agreed to retire the Brightline fixture range by year-end. Remaining stock moves to clearance pricing next month, and accounts on standing orders get migrated to the Lumetta range. Trade-in incentives were approved in principle. The confidential note on next steps sits just below.

board note of bajof-bajeg: The pricing group signed off on a budget of $13.4 million for Project Sildor. The renewal with Lamixek Holdings closes at $48.9 million a year, 49 percent above the last contract.

Alert: AuditScope viewer latency exceeded 4s at p95 for three consecutive intervals. Likely cause is the unindexed date-range query introduced in last week's release; rollback is staged but not applied. No data loss, read-only impact. For the sync: decision needed on rollback vs. hotfix. Query traces and the proposed index change are on the internal page here.

operations page: https://jenkins.zemvarcloud.local/job/merge_requests/repo/build/73930b4b30f0a8ed

/*
 * MAX_PREVIEW_ROWS caps how many rows the Gristmark CSV import wizard
 * parses for the column-mapping preview. Raising this past 500 caused
 * browser stalls on wide files during the Harborlane pilot, so we keep
 * it conservative. The full file is still validated server-side after
 * mapping is confirmed; this constant only affects the preview pane.
 * The value was last tuned against the build whose token appears below.
 */

session token of fahap-hawip = htk31_7852f2b3276dba2738f98fa97f92237